Transaction 338217dd259a2cda7543428dd1f03726fc4fcf63d8153623dd40faa8f2143a5c
1 Input
1 Output
-
338217dd259a2cda7543428dd1f03726fc4fcf63d8153623dd40faa8f2143a5c:0
- value
- 8556880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b80e1622b2d1260014fee70ae8c02d6e2e02c548 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HnCD3RDFwoDcgvKxLq47FPQYvs3u8r5J6